How Much Does ServiceTitan Cost Per Month?
ServiceTitan uses a per-technician pricing model, meaning your monthly cost scales with every technician on the platform. They offer three plan tiers — Starter, Essentials, and The Works — but no pricing is published. You must sit through a sales demo to get a quote.
The figures below are compiled from verified user reports across G2, Capterra, Reddit, BBB complaints, and third-party analysis platforms. Your actual quote may vary based on company size, revenue, and negotiation.
ServiceTitan has stated their platform is “not optimized for a company with 3 or fewer technicians.” If you’re a solo operator or small crew, they may decline to onboard you entirely.

ServiceTitan Pricing by Team Size
Here’s what ServiceTitan costs at different team sizes — using the midpoint of user-reported pricing ranges. Implementation fees are one-time but included to show true Year 1 investment.
| Team Size | Starter | Essentials | The Works | Implementation |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 3 techs | $735/mo | $1,050/mo | $1,500/mo | $5K–$15K |
| 5 techs | $1,225/mo | $1,750/mo | $2,500/mo | $10K–$25K |
| 10 techs | $2,450/mo | $3,500/mo | $5,000/mo | $15K–$35K |
| 20 techs | $4,900/mo | $7,000/mo | $10,000/mo | $25K–$50K+ |
| 50 techs | $12,250/mo | $17,500/mo | $25,000/mo | $50K+ |

Implementation Fees & Timeline
Unlike most modern SaaS tools, ServiceTitan charges a substantial one-time implementation fee — and the process takes months, not minutes.
- Implementation cost: $5,000 to $50,000+ depending on plan tier, number of technicians, and operational complexity. This is a non-refundable upfront payment.
- Timeline: 3–6 months typical, with some users reporting 12+ months before being fully onboarded. BBB complaints document cases of users paying for a full year without completing implementation.
- Data migration is manual and time-consuming. Customer data, pricebooks, and service agreements must be re-built within the ServiceTitan framework. There is no quick CSV import and go.
- Training is required. Multiple G2 reviews describe ServiceTitan as having a steep learning curve — one Reddit user wrote it’s “almost like it’s too big to where my people are scared to dive in and learn.”

Contracts & Cancellation Fees
ServiceTitan requires a 12+ month annual contract for all plans. There is no month-to-month option. Early termination fees have been documented in BBB complaints ranging from $5,000 to $20,000+.
If you realize ServiceTitan isn’t the right fit three months in, you’re still on the hook for the remaining 9 months of your contract — plus you’ve already paid the implementation fee.
